show system temperature
Use the show system temperature command to display information about the
system temperature and fan status.
Syntax
show system temperature
Default Configuration
This command has no default configuration.
Command Mode
User Exec mode, Privileged Exec mode, Global Configuration mode and all
Configuration submodes
User Guidelines
The system temperature is read from one or more sensors placed at critical
locations on the PCB. Status ranges are subdivided into Ok (Cool), Non-
critical (Warm), and Critical (Hot). Each status range has a lower, mid-range,
and upper limit with the upper limit of the lower temperature status being
